14:22 — Load test against the Fernbrook checkout flow ramped to 400 virtual shoppers. Payment intents queued normally, but the Tollhouse fraud pre-check began timing out at 350 concurrent sessions, silently approving by fallback. We halted the ramp and captured the run for review. The trace token identifying the exact test build is recorded immediately below this entry.

build token for kagaf-hahof: htk14_9d3d4d26d7d8de

Handover: Tollgate payment retries

Welcome aboard! Short version: Tollgate now attaches an idempotency key to every payment retry so duplicate charges can't slip through. Keys live in Redis with a 24h TTL. Don't touch the retry backoff without pinging me first. The service reads the following settings at startup.

settings of yajof-bagaf:
ZORWYN_LOG_LEVEL=warn
ZORWYN_METRICS_HOST=metrics.zorwyn.nelvroworks.corp
ZORWYN_POOL_SIZE=4

## Further Reading — TideTrack Widget

Before cutting a release, please review how the TideTrack widget caches harbor predictions: stale tables are tolerated for up to six hours, after which the widget falls back to the coarse regional model. Release managers should confirm that the prediction dataset version bundled in the build matches the schema expected by the rendering layer, since mismatches fail silently on older clients. The compatibility matrix and release checklist are maintained on the internal page below.

wiki page, yajep-taweg: https://gitlab.zemvarsys.corp/spaces/dash/pages/36fc5fc27c64